WebActually, most Tesla chargers will draw about 15 amps when using Level 1 charging. 125% of 15 amps is 18.75, which means that even a 20-amp breaker should be enough. But then, if you go for the 20-amp breaker, you can’t have any other electrical appliances connected to the same electrical circuit. WebJul 7, 2024 · A 40-amp circuit requires 8-gauge wire at more than $3 per foot. Stepping up the amperage for faster charging requires thicker-gauge wire, which costs more. WebJul 26, 2024 · Level 1 “trickle charging” requires 15-20 amp service and can be done using the standard 120v outlet that most household electronics use (with an adapter). Level 2 chargers use 240v electrical circuits (similar to those used by washers and dryers) and run up to 80 amp service.

WebSep 26, 2024 · Tesla home charging ranges from 120 volts at 15 amps to 240 volts at 48 amps. Webvehicles. Installed with a 50-amp circuit breaker, this outlet enables a recharge rate of about 25 miles per hour. Consult a licensed electrician to review the electrical load of your home prior to installation. They will design your charging system and obtain a permit for a general purpose NEMA 14-50 outlet from your local building department. On Wednesday, the Hong Kong Economic Times reported that Tesla plans to cut prices … impact investment ghanaWebA 120 volt outlet will supply 2 to 3 miles of range per hour charged. If you charge overnight and drive less than 30 to 40 miles per day, this option should meet your typical charging needs.
